Is Mercyhealth System a good nursing home group?

Across 3 rated homes, Mercyhealth System averages 4.7★ on official inspection ratings — above the roughly 3.0★ national average. 100% of its rated homes earn 4★ or better, while 0% sit at 1–2★. That’s a stronger-than-average record overall, but ratings still vary from location to location — judge each home on its own.

A group-wide number can’t tell you about the specific home near you — quality varies by location. Open each home below to see its own official inspection rating before you decide.

About Mercyhealth System

Mercyhealth is a nonprofit, vertically integrated regional health care system serving communities in northern Illinois and southern Wisconsin, operating over 85 facilities—including hospitals, clinics, post-acute care, retail services, and an insurance arm.

Mercyhealth traces its founding to 1883 in Janesville, Wisconsin, originally established by Henry Palmer, and has grown substantially since then.

Mercyhealth operates as a nonprofit organization. Its structure includes hospitals, clinics, post-acute care offerings (such as skilled nursing), and a wholly owned insurance company, reflecting a diversified, vertically integrated model.

The system serves southern Wisconsin and northern Illinois, with over 85 facilities in approximately 55 communities.

Mercyhealth’s core service areas include hospital-based care, clinic-based services, post-acute care (such as skilled nursing and rehabilitation), retail services, and a proprietary insurance company. Their skilled nursing rehabilitation program includes short-term and long-term care across three centers—one example being the Mercyhealth Care Center, a 34-bed skilled nursing facility adjacent to Mercyhealth Hospital–Harvard, rated five stars by CMS for multiple years.

How are these ratings determined?
The ratings shown are official government inspection ratings. They combine on-site health inspections, staffing levels, and clinical quality measures into an overall score from 1 to 5 stars for each home — the same official data families and regulators use.
